Understanding Non-Sparking Wrenches
To start, let’s clarify what non-sparking wrenches are. These specialized tools are made from materials that don’t produce sparks when they strike a hard surface. Common materials include bronze and aluminum. If you’re using these tools, the rationale is straightforward: they reduce the risk of ignition, making them a safer choice in volatile environments. However, safety isn’t just about the tools you use—it’s also about knowing their limitations.

Real-World Applications
You may be wondering where these tools find their most practical use. Industries such as oil and gas, chemical manufacturing, and mining often implement non-sparking wrenches. For instance, in a recent project in the oil industry, workers had to perform maintenance on high-pressure gas lines. The use of non-sparking tools reduced the risk of sparks igniting flammable gases, allowing the project to proceed safely and efficiently. By utilizing these specialized wrenches, businesses can not only comply with safety regulations, but also protect their workers and assets.
